We are developing an L-band (1.3 GHz) high-current relativistic klystron (5 kA, 500 kV) for repetitive (200 pps) pulsing. We have designed and tested an extraction cavity that removes energy from the modulated electron beam and radiates it into an anechoic chamber in the TM01 mode. Peak power in excess of 450 MW has been measured for a single shot and 275 MW for a sustained burst producing 3.3 kW of average power. This klystron is now being transitioned to a long pulse (> 500 ns), single shot facility.
